Visual Basic gir programmerere muligheten til å opprette , manipulere og slette database poster og objekter . Flere databaseobjekter er inkludert i kompilatoren levert av Microsoft. Ved hjelp av noen få linjer med kode , kan en utvikler opprette en Access database på fly og bruke den til å laste poster. Instruksjoner
en
Importer ADOX navnerommet . Dette biblioteket av funksjoner og egenskaper er nødvendig for å opprette databasen . Importen linje av koden er lagt inn på toppen av siden. Syntaksen er : Importen ADOX
2
Instantiate katalogen klassen . . Den katalog klasse har metodene som er tilgjengelige for å opprette databasen . Syntaksen er : Dim myCatalog Som Catalog = Ny Catalog ( )
3
Lag sammenhengen streng. Forbindelsen strengen inneholder all nødvendig informasjon for å koble til en database . Den laster inn drivere , brukernavn og passord ( hvis nødvendig) , og navnet på databasen. Forbindelsen strengen nedenfor inneholder de opplysninger som kreves for å opprette databasen i dette utvalget : Dim myConnection som StringmyConnection = " Provider = Microsoft.Jet.OLEDB.4.0 ; datakilde = C: \\ myDBFolder \\ myNewAccessDB.mdb ; Jet OLEDB : Motortype = 5 "
4
Lag databasen. Med forbindelse strengen skape og katalogen klassen startes , kan du nå opprette databasen. Følgende funksjon oppretter en database kalt " myNewAccessDB.mdb " : myCatalog.Create ( myConnection )
5
Bekreft at databasen er opprettet. Selv om det ikke er nødvendig , bekrefter database skapelse er god programmering praksis . Koden skriver under bekreftelse tekst til konsollen : Console.WriteLine ( " . MyNewDatabase har blitt opprettet ")
6
Lukk katalog variabel. Fjerne variable frigjør minne og ressurser på datamaskinen. Sette en variabel til " ingenting" fjerner den fra minnet : myCatalog = ingenting